How can organizations (not just schools) respond to new literacies?
New literacies shifts our mindset in a few ways...
Bookspace to Cyberspace
Published to Participatory*
Individuated to Collaborative
Author-centric to Distributed
Expert-oriented to Collective Intelligence

*The battle to define Web 2.0 has been great...After the dust settles, I anticipate web 2.0 being defined by one word, PARTICIPATION.
Our organizations may respond to modern literacy by:
- Increasing focus on collectives as the unit of production.
- Distributing expertise/authority.
- Creating open/fluid collective spaces.
- Fostering relations in emerging digital media spaces.
The Microsoft school reflected some of these design considerations in 2006, but most promising is the development of the thousands of inexpensive collaboration apps that enable all organizations to respond effectively.
